    A bit of background info: When I returned from the Orient, I developed a thirty-year plan to teach the three treasures of Taoism, called jing-chi-shen in Chinese and body-energy-spirit in English. The summer’s retreats for 2007, TAOIST YOGA and the Gods Playing in the Clouds Instructor course, focused on developing the second treasure, chi-energy. Taoist Yoga is based on one of the foundation practices in China to open up the body’s energy channels and to learn to feel energy. It's something I spent years practicing and is a great way to accelerate your current chi gung practice.
